Nigel and Simon's points are good. I worked for years in an advertising 
agency. Punchy is good. Pros get paid a lot of money writing headlines 
for ads.

So how do we summarize our point in once sentence? Remembering that this 
first letter is directed at content providers (Fox) and network 
providers (Comcast and Fios). We can do other letters later directed at 
people like the FCC.

How about:

"I am writing because your increasing use of the digital CCI flag being 
set to Copy Once will cause you to lose me as a viewer."

Everything else is explained: what CCI is, what Copy Freely is. But 
isn't this statement the heart of the matter?
